, ,

کتاب ساخت Custom Controls with Undo/Redo Capabilities for Data Governance Tools in WPF for Enterprise

تومان249,950

انتخاب پلن

torobpay
هر قسط با ترب‌پی: تومان62,488
۴ قسط ماهانه. بدون سود، چک و ضامن.

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

📚 کتاب آموزشی جامع

📚 اطلاعات کتاب

عنوان کتاب: کتاب ساخت Custom Controls with Undo/Redo Capabilities for Data Governance Tools in WPF for Enterprise

موضوع کلی: برنامه نویسی

موضوع میانی: WPF (Windows Presentation Foundation)

📋 سرفصل‌های کتاب (100 موضوع)

  • 1. معرفی WPF و جایگاه آن در توسعه دسکتاپ
  • 2. آشنایی با XAML و مفاهیم پایه‌ای آن
  • 3. پنجره‌ها، صفحات و User Interface در WPF
  • 4. مدیریت رویدادها (Events) و Event Handling
  • 5. سیستم Layout در WPF: Grid, StackPanel, DockPanel و Canvas
  • 6. مفهوم Data Binding و انواع آن (OneWay, TwoWay, OneTime)
  • 7. Source, Path, Mode و UpdateSourceTrigger در Data Binding
  • 8. Resources در WPF: StaticResource و DynamicResource
  • 9. Styles: یکپارچه‌سازی ظاهر کنترل‌ها
  • 10. Control Templates: تغییر ظاهر کنترل‌های موجود
  • 11. Data Templates: نمایش داده‌های پیچیده در UI
  • 12. Converters: استفاده از IValueConverter برای تبدیل داده‌ها
  • 13. Validation در WPF: IDataErrorInfo و ValidationRules
  • 14. مقدمه‌ای بر MVVM Pattern و مزایای آن
  • 15. Command Pattern و پیاده‌سازی ICommand و RelayCommand
  • 16. تفاوت UserControl و Custom Control در WPF
  • 17. شروع به کار با Custom Control: کلاس Control و Generic.xaml
  • 18. معماری Templating در Custom Controls
  • 19. Dependency Properties: تعریف، کاربرد و Register کردن
  • 20. Attached Properties: توسعه قابلیت‌های کنترل‌ها
  • 21. Routed Events: Bubbling, Tunneling و Direct
  • 22. Focus Management و Keyboard Navigation در Custom Controls
  • 23. Visual State Manager: مدیریت حالت‌های بصری کنترل
  • 24. Content Model و ContentProperty در Custom Controls
  • 25. استفاده از Custom Control Library و Nuget Packages
  • 26. Template Parts: اتصال کد C# به Visual Tree
  • 27. Themes و Style‌های پیشرفته برای Custom Controls
  • 28. ایجاد یک Custom Control ساده: یک دکمه تعاملی
  • 29. ساخت Custom Control برای نمایش و ویرایش داده‌ها
  • 30. پیاده‌سازی Custom Control با پشتیبانی از Validation
  • 31. اصول طراحی API و Properties برای Custom Controls
  • 32. مدیریت ورودی‌های کاربر (Mouse, Keyboard) در Custom Controls
  • 33. Overriding OnApplyTemplate و Dependency Property Callbacks
  • 34. INotifyPropertyChanged و پیاده‌سازی در ViewModels
  • 35. استفاده از Behaviors برای افزودن قابلیت به کنترل‌ها
  • 36. معرفی مفهوم Undo/Redo و ضرورت آن در ابزارهای سازمانی
  • 37. چالش‌های پیاده‌سازی سیستم Undo/Redo
  • 38. Command Pattern به عنوان پایه Undo/Redo
  • 39. طراحی اینترفیس IUndoableCommand
  • 40. ساختار Transaction History Stack برای ذخیره دستورات
  • 41. Memento Pattern: ذخیره و بازیابی حالت شیء
  • 42. State Management برای عملیات Undo/Redo
  • 43. Grouping Commands: ترکیب چندین تغییر در یک عملیات Undo
  • 44. زمانبندی و اجرای عملیات Undo/Redo
  • 45. مدیریت حافظه و بهینه‌سازی در سیستم Undo/Redo
  • 46. Serializing Undo/Redo History برای persistence
  • 47. پیاده‌سازی Checkpoints و Save Points
  • 48. Dealing with Concurrent Changes در محیط‌های چندکاربره
  • 49. ساخت یک UndoManager مرکزی برای کل برنامه
  • 50. استفاده از ObservableCollection برای ردیابی تغییرات مجموعه‌ها
  • 51. پیاده‌سازی Undo/Redo برای یک مدل داده ساده (CRUD)
  • 52. معرفی مفهوم "Dirty State" و کاربرد آن
  • 53. Event Aggregator برای اطلاع‌رسانی تغییرات در معماری Undo/Redo
  • 54. ادغام Undo/Redo در MVVM Pattern
  • 55. ViewModel Commands برای عملیات Undo و Redo
  • 56. معماری Undo/Redo برای Custom Controls
  • 57. ثبت تغییرات Dependency Property در UndoManager
  • 58. Wrapper Classes برای Properties با قابلیت Undo/Redo
  • 59. پیاده‌سازی Undo/Redo برای Custom Content Editor Control
  • 60. Undo/Redo در Custom Controls با Data Binding پیچیده
  • 61. ردیابی تغییرات در مجموعه‌های داده (Collections) برای Undo/Redo
  • 62. Contextual Undo/Redo: محدود کردن به یک کنترل خاص
  • 63. Universal Undo/Redo: اعمال در سطح کل برنامه
  • 64. مدیریت Undo/Redo در Nested Controls
  • 65. نمایش وضعیت Undo/Redo در UI (مثلاً Enable/Disable دکمه‌ها)
  • 66. بهینه‌سازی عملکرد Undo/Redo در کنترل‌های پیچیده
  • 67. Undo/Redo برای عملیات Drag & Drop در Custom Controls
  • 68. ادغام Undo/Redo با Attached Properties سفارشی
  • 69. Undo/Redo برای تغییرات Style و Template در زمان اجرا
  • 70. پشتیبانی از Undo/Redo در حالت‌های مختلف Custom Control
  • 71. ایجاد یک Undoable Property Wrapper عمومی
  • 72. Hooking Dependency Property Changed Callbacks برای ثبت تغییرات
  • 73. پیاده‌سازی یک Custom Undoable Textbox
  • 74. Undo/Redo برای تغییرات Selection در یک Custom List Control
  • 75. پشتیبانی از Undo/Redo در Commands داخلی Custom Control
  • 76. مفاهیم Data Governance و اهمیت آن در سازمان‌ها
  • 77. نقش Custom Controls در ابزارهای Data Governance
  • 78. طراحی مدل‌های داده برای Data Governance (Metadata, Data Quality)
  • 79. اعمال Business Rules و Validation پیشرفته در Custom Controls
  • 80. Auditing و Logging تغییرات داده‌ها برای Data Governance
  • 81. Data Lineage و Provenance در ابزارهای Governance
  • 82. Data Quality Management از طریق Custom Controls
  • 83. Workflows و Approval Processes در Context Governance
  • 84. Security Considerations: Authorization و Authentication در WPF Enterprise
  • 85. Data Masking و Anonymization در UI برای امنیت داده‌ها
  • 86. Performance Tuning برای WPF Applications در محیط Enterprise
  • 87. Scalability Patterns برای ابزارهای WPF Data Governance
  • 88. Deploying WPF Applications: ClickOnce, MSIX و MSI
  • 89. Internationalization و Localization برای Enterprise Apps
  • 90. Accessibility (A11y) در طراحی Custom Controls
  • 91. Error Handling و Exception Management در برنامه‌های WPF
  • 92. Logging و Monitoring در محیط Enterprise با WPF
  • 93. Cross-Platform Considerations (Optional: .NET MAUI / Uno Platform)
  • 94. Integration با سیستم‌های موجود (APIs, Databases, Web Services)
  • 95. Unit Testing Custom Controls و منطق Undo/Redo
  • 96. UI Automation Testing برای Custom Controls
  • 97. Performance Profiling و Memory Optimization در WPF
  • 98. Design Patterns پیشرفته در توسعه Custom Controls
  • 99. Best Practices برای Maintenance و Extendibility Custom Controls
  • 100. آینده WPF و .NET در راهکارهای Enterprise

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

دیدگاهها

هیچ دیدگاهی برای این محصول نوشته نشده است.

اولین نفری باشید که دیدگاهی را ارسال می کنید برای “کتاب ساخت Custom Controls with Undo/Redo Capabilities for Data Governance Tools in WPF for Enterprise”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ا